County Travel To Bury

|
Image for County Travel To Bury

Stockport County will be followed by another large travelling contigent, hoping to top 2000 tomorrow in the Manchester derby against Bury.

County were beaten 2-0 at Bury last year, but won 1-0 the season before.

Gigg Lane has been known to not take the rain too well recently, but after a win against Norwich in the FA Cup on Tuesday Bury will be doing all they can to get the game on and push the pressure onwards.

Bury are without a manager after sacking Chris Casper at the beginning of the week, but did beat Championship Norwich 2-1 in the FA Cup replay on Tuesday night at Gigg Lane.

Bury Team News:

Former County target Simon Yeo is available after being ineligible to take part in the FA Cup game on Tuesday night.

But caretaker manager Chris Brass should stick with the side that beat Norwich 2-1.

Player to watch: Andy Bishop

The guy is a top quality striker, and has really been under constant speculation as he continues to score goals.

He’s got 12 goals this season, and will look to add to his tally tomorrow.

Stockport County Team News:

Matty McNeil has undergone a hernia operation and will be out for up to two months.

Rob Clare will be back in rehabilition on Monday but will also be out for much longer.

Gareth Owen and Ashley Williams will be out and should return in next weeks two reserve games.

Dominic Blizzard is fit again and could feature tomorrow.

Leon McSweeney went for stitches after a clash with Michael Rose in training, but he will be fit for Bury.

Otherwise its a full squad for Jim to choose from.

Player to watch: Anthony Elding

Four in four games for Eldinho, can he make it five and try and bring County to their fifth straight league win?
